The global coffee arabica seed oil market is forecast to expand at a CAGR of 8.6% and thereby increase from a value of US$1.54 Bn in 2023 to US$2.75 Bn by the end of 2030. The Coffee Arabica Seed Oil market encompasses the production, processing, and distribution of oil extracted from the seeds of Coffea arabica, commonly known as Arabica coffee beans. Skin and Hair Benefits: Coffee Arabica Seed Oil is prized for its skincare and haircare benefits, making it a popular ingredient in beauty and personal care products. Rich in antioxidants, vitamins, and fatty acids, Coffee Arabica Seed Oil helps to nourish, hydrate, and rejuvenate the skin, promoting a healthy complexion and combating signs of aging such as wrinkles, fine lines, and sun damage. Additionally, the oil's emollient and conditioning properties make it suitable for haircare products, helping to moisturize the scalp, strengthen hair strands, and improve overall hair health. Growing Awareness of Aromatherapy Benefits: Aromatherapy, the practice of using aromatic essential oils for therapeutic purposes, is gaining popularity as a holistic approach to wellness and relaxation. Coffee Arabica Seed Oil, with its rich, aromatic scent reminiscent of freshly brewed coffee, is valued in aromatherapy for its uplifting, invigorating, and mood-enhancing properties. When used in diffusers, massage oils, or bath products, Coffee Arabica Seed Oil can help alleviate stress, boost mental alertness, and promote a sense of well-being.
